WebOct 11, 2024 · The red cell distribution width (RDW) blood test measures how equal your red blood cells are in size and shape. The RDW test is one of several tests included in a complete blood count (CBC), a standard set of labs done on a blood sample. 1. Webwhat is RDW on FBC? red cell distribution width - measure of the range of variation of RBC volume in a blood sample. higher RDW = greater variation in size . (the width of the distribution curve, not the width of the actual cells). normal is 11-16% WebJan 7, 2024 · There are a number of symptoms that people with low MCHC levels often have.
